15. Jerseys

When teams aren’t reaching expectations, fans let them know – usually by booing. But in severe instances, fans part way with their team sweater as a method of self-excommunication from the franchise. Someone threw a Canucks sweater onto the ice. Brian Dumoulin kindly returned it to the stands….
